"Let the Finance Bill Reflect the People's Priorities" – DG Francis Mwangangi

Machakos Deputy Governor Francis Mwangangi has urged the national government to craft the 2025/2026 Finance Bill in a way that aligns with the needs and aspirations of ordinary Kenyans.

Speaking during a multi-stakeholder forum on the proposed bill, DG Mwangangi emphasized that the people are not opposed to taxation but are concerned about the value they receive in return.

“Let the Finance Bill reflect the people’s priorities,” he said. “Kenyans want their taxes to translate into improved services, more jobs, and meaningful development.”
He noted that discussions during the forum revealed a strong desire among citizens for the government to channel more funds into key economic sectors with the potential to generate opportunities and uplift livelihoods.

DG Mwangangi also stressed the importance of upholding the constitutional provision that mandates 15% of national revenue be allocated to counties. With a proposed budget of over Ksh 4 trillion, he said, devolved units must get their rightful share to ensure equitable development and the full realization of devolution.

“The architects of the 2010 Constitution envisioned a nation where development is felt at every corner. That dream can only be achieved if counties are well-resourced,” he added.
Corruption was another dominant theme during the discussions. Participants called on national leaders to strengthen accountability mechanisms, fight graft decisively, and restore public trust in institutions.

In his closing remarks, Mwangangi reiterated that the public is not against the Finance Bill per se, but they demand a transparent and responsive government that prioritizes their welfare.

The forum served as a clear reminder that citizens are keenly following fiscal policies and are ready to voice their expectations as stakeholders in national development.
